The author, a lifelong resident of California, predominantly in the Salinas Valley, sets her "factual novel" within this familiar backdrop. "The Bracero" chronicles Diego's journey from his southern Mexican hometown to the United States and back, traversing the expanse of Mexico amid numerous trials. Within the narrative unfolds the author's depiction of American warmth and benevolence. Diego, anticipating skepticism or even hostility, discovers a stark contrast upon encountering the inhabitants of the Salinas Valley, their kindness far surpassing his initial expectations.
